Cross-Border Freight Forwarding Across Central and Southern Africa

SLS Trading is one of the leading cross-border freight forwarding operators in the Central and Southern African region. We manage 35,000 metric tonnes of cargo per month to and from the DRC, handling both northbound reagent imports for mining operations and southbound exports of copper and cobalt.

Our freight forwarding service covers road transport, multimodal solutions, and full supply chain coordination across seven active corridors. In 2020, SLS was moving less than 15,000 MT per month. By 2025, that volume had grown to 35,000 MT monthly. Our target for 2026 and 2027 is 50,000+ MT per month.

Logistics Warehousing and Storage Across the DRC, Zambia, and Angola

SLS operates strategic warehousing and storage facilities at the key hub points along its corridor network. With over 34,000 square metres of covered warehouse space and more than 156,000 square metres of open yard, we provide the storage infrastructure that keeps high-volume mining logistics moving without interruption.

Every facility is positioned to minimise transit time, reduce cargo handling steps, and provide secure, monitored storage for high-value mining inputs and mineral exports.

Kolwezi, DRC

19,000 SQM covered warehouse and canopy. 100,000 SQM of land. Primary Copperbelt hub.

Lubumbashi, DRC

18,000 SQM of operational land with offices. Administrative and commercial hub.

Ndola, Zambia

12,000 SQM covered warehouse and canopy. 41,000 SQM of land. Copperbelt corridor transit point.

Luau, Angola

2,000 SQM covered and closed warehouse. Rail transfer point on the Dilolo corridor.

Rail Logistics Solutions Along the DRC, Angola, Zambia and Tanzania Corridors

SLS Trading operates a dedicated rail logistics service along the Dilolo corridor, moving copper cathodes and mining reagents from the Copperbelt to the ports of Luanda, Dar es Salaam, and Ndola. With a fleet of locomotives and 100+ rail wagons, we provide a reliable, scalable alternative to road transport for high-volume mineral exports.

Rail transport on our corridors offers mining exporters a lower cost per tonne for large volumes, reduced road wear and security risk, and direct port access through Lobito and Luanda. Capacity scales in alignment with mine production cycles.

Mining Reagent Supply and International Trading Into the Copperbelt

Beyond logistics, SLS Trading operates an active international trading business, importing mining reagents into the Copperbelt and supplying them locally to mine operators. This gives our clients a single partner for both the procurement of reagents and their delivery to site, eliminating the coordination risk that comes from managing multiple suppliers.

Our trading volumes have grown steadily alongside our logistics operations, reaching 20,000 to 25,000 MT per month of imported reagents, plus a further 5,000 to 10,000 MT per month of sulphuric acid supplied locally within the Copperbelt.
